Motor sport chief to visit Botswana
Wednesday, May 22, 2013

Botswana Motor Sport Association (BMSA) secretary general Joseph Khengere confirmed to Mmegi Sport yesterday that they have been in consultations with the FIA since affiliating to them earlier this year and the president will pay a visit to Botswana.
Khengere said Botswana stands to benefit much from Todt's visit because the country is new within FIA circles.He said Botswana had been considered as part of South Africa, but recently managed to secure its own FIA affiliation, hence the visit.
